From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913) (web1913)
Oppressor \Op*press"or\, n. [L.]
One who oppresses; one who imposes unjust burdens on others;
one who harasses others with unjust laws or unreasonable
severity.
The orphan pines while the oppressor feeds. --Shak.
To relieve the oppressed and to punish the oppressor.
--Swift.
From WordNet (r) 1.7 (wn)
oppressor
n : a person of authority who subjects others to undue pressures
